I was inspired by the game, Sin and Punishment, recently and I wanted to try and make a cursor that moved in real time when the mouse moved. This experiment is working pretty well so far. (Had to do some difficult math and guesswork, though)

The cursor aiming code is bit "laggy", but I'll figure out to do fix it! (possibly...maybe)

BTW the spinning icosahedron is simply there for me to visually check for lag. It does nothing else. Also, after clicking the dot, do not resize the window, and if there any black bars around the window, please close the world and reopen it until they are gone.
